Bacterial taxon 354242 Locus CJJ81176_0652 Protein WP_002785900.1
hydrogenase accessory protein HypB
Campylobacter jejuni subsp. jejuni 81-176Length 247 aa, Gene hypB, UniProt A0A0H3PAZ6
Bacterial taxon 354242 Locus CJJ81176_0652 Protein WP_002785900.1
Length 247 aa, Gene hypB, UniProt A0A0H3PAZ6